Consultancy to Redesign the African Governance Institute Website

Jointly supported by UNDP and UNECA, the African Governance Institute AGI based in Dakar, Senegal is a pan-African centre of excellence conceived to contribute to the development of an innovative reflection on the governance challenges with which the African continent is faced and to help implement solutions to be adopted. Due to its interdisciplinary approach and to its contribution to the intellectual dialogue on governance, the AGI serves as a forum for discussions and exchanges on Public Policy and for dialogue between different governance actors including policy makers, civil society actors, the private sector, researchers and academics.

To this end, UNDP is seeking an IT and Knowledge Management Consultant to provide technical backstopping to the AGI in revamping its communications and knowledge management strategy including the redesign of the AGI website.
